New Botanary Words

Name Pronunciation Meaning
capillipes  cap-ILL-ih-peez  Slender foot, from the Latin "capillus" meaning thread or hair, and "pes" from the Latin word for foot  
Chukrasia  chuck-RAY-see-uh  from the Bengali name for several trees in the genus
